Xinerama & Dualhead : Choix du moniteur principal.
3 réponses
Vargas Emmanuel
Salut la liste,
j'ai une question dont je n'arrive pas a trouver de soluce via google
alors je me tourne vers vous.
J'ai essaye de mettre mon poste en dualhead avec xinerama, pas de pb a
l'horizon sauf que je n'arrive pas a lui faire comprendre que je veux
que l'ecran principal soit le TFT et non le CRT. Ce qui est genant par
exemple pour l'opengl qui ne tourne que sur l'ecran principale.
Histoire de compliquer un peu la sauce sur mes recherches via google je
n'arrive pas a trouver un mot en anglais pour signier "ecran principal" ?
Je tourne avec kdm, et j'ai donc modifie le /etc/kde3/kdm/Xservers pour
rajouter +xinerama a la ligne de code de demarrage.
Bon je n'ai essaye qu'avec kde pour l'instant mais je ne pense pas qu un
autre WM changerait grand chose vu que au demarrage de KDM, j'ai tjrs la
fenetre de login sur l'ecran CRT (le digiview dans le XF86Config ci dessus)
Je ne sais pas si je dois changer qqchose dans le XF86Config ou dans la
conf de KDM si au moins vous pourriez m'eclairer la dessus et me dire
vers ou regarder ca m'aiderait pas mal deja.
A noter que j'ai deja essayer de tourner les screen0 et les screen1 du
XF86Config-4 dans tous les sens sans vraiment de success :(
En vous remerciant par avance!
Emmanuel Vargas.
--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to debian-user-french-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
J'ai deja essaye il y a quelques version de faire le meme chose sur mon laptop, jusqu'a ce que je tombe, dans la doc de nVidia je crois, sur une petite phrase du genre "Sur les laptops et/ou geforce 2 go, l'ecran externe est considere comme le master". Ca date du temps du kernel 2.4, donc il est possible que les gars de nVidia se soit grouiller le derriere pour regler ca. Personnellement, je roule deux serveurs X lorsque je suis en dualhead. Ca fonctionne bien, mais on ne peut pas deplacer de fenetre d'un desktop a l'autre.
Nic Cola -- () ascii ribbon campaign - against html e-mail / - against microsoft attachments
-- Pensez à lire la FAQ de la liste avant de poser une question : http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to with a subject of "unsubscribe". Trouble? Contact
Salut
que l'ecran principal soit le TFT et non le CRT. Ce qui est genant par
J'ai deja essaye il y a quelques version de faire le meme chose sur mon
laptop, jusqu'a ce que je tombe, dans la doc de nVidia je crois, sur une
petite phrase du genre "Sur les laptops et/ou geforce 2 go, l'ecran externe
est considere comme le master". Ca date du temps du kernel 2.4, donc il est
possible que les gars de nVidia se soit grouiller le derriere pour regler ca.
Personnellement, je roule deux serveurs X lorsque je suis en dualhead. Ca
fonctionne bien, mais on ne peut pas deplacer de fenetre d'un desktop a
l'autre.
Nic Cola
--
() ascii ribbon campaign - against html e-mail
/ - against microsoft attachments
--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to debian-user-french-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
J'ai deja essaye il y a quelques version de faire le meme chose sur mon laptop, jusqu'a ce que je tombe, dans la doc de nVidia je crois, sur une petite phrase du genre "Sur les laptops et/ou geforce 2 go, l'ecran externe est considere comme le master". Ca date du temps du kernel 2.4, donc il est possible que les gars de nVidia se soit grouiller le derriere pour regler ca. Personnellement, je roule deux serveurs X lorsque je suis en dualhead. Ca fonctionne bien, mais on ne peut pas deplacer de fenetre d'un desktop a l'autre.
Nic Cola -- () ascii ribbon campaign - against html e-mail / - against microsoft attachments
-- Pensez à lire la FAQ de la liste avant de poser une question : http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to with a subject of "unsubscribe". Trouble? Contact
Vargas Emmanuel
>> que l'ecran principal soit le TFT et non le CRT. Ce qui est genant par
J'ai deja essaye il y a quelques version de faire le meme chose sur
> mon laptop, jusqu'a ce que je tombe, dans la doc de nVidia je crois, > sur une petite phrase du genre "Sur les laptops et/ou geforce 2 go, > l'ecran externe est considere comme le master". Ca date du temps du > kernel 2.4, donc il est possible que les gars de nVidia se soit > grouiller le derriere pour regler ca.
Ah oui j'ai oublie de preciser le hardware derriere :) Il s'agit d'un GeforceFX5950. Donc c'est pas du laptop ni de la geforce2. Je vais voir si je trouve ca dans la doc nvidia-glx mais j'avais deja regarde....
Personnellement, je roule deux serveurs X lorsque je suis en dualhead.
> Ca fonctionne bien, mais on ne peut pas deplacer de fenetre d'un > desktop a l'autre.
Oui, c'est la configue que j'avais avant de vouloir essayer xinerama, si jamais j'y arrive vraiment pas j'y retournerais mais j'aime pas avoir un probleme non resolu! :) Je trouve quand meme fout que le master soit le CRT et pas le TFT ....
-- Pensez à lire la FAQ de la liste avant de poser une question : http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to with a subject of "unsubscribe". Trouble? Contact
>> que l'ecran principal soit le TFT et non le CRT. Ce qui est genant
par
J'ai deja essaye il y a quelques version de faire le meme chose sur
> mon laptop, jusqu'a ce que je tombe, dans la doc de nVidia je crois,
> sur une petite phrase du genre "Sur les laptops et/ou geforce 2 go,
> l'ecran externe est considere comme le master". Ca date du temps du
> kernel 2.4, donc il est possible que les gars de nVidia se soit
> grouiller le derriere pour regler ca.
Ah oui j'ai oublie de preciser le hardware derriere :)
Il s'agit d'un GeforceFX5950. Donc c'est pas du laptop ni de la geforce2.
Je vais voir si je trouve ca dans la doc nvidia-glx mais j'avais deja
regarde....
Personnellement, je roule deux serveurs X lorsque je suis en
dualhead.
> Ca fonctionne bien, mais on ne peut pas deplacer de fenetre d'un
> desktop a l'autre.
Oui, c'est la configue que j'avais avant de vouloir essayer xinerama, si
jamais j'y arrive vraiment pas j'y retournerais mais j'aime pas avoir un
probleme non resolu! :)
Je trouve quand meme fout que le master soit le CRT et pas le TFT ....
--
Pensez à lire la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to debian-user-french-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org
J'ai deja essaye il y a quelques version de faire le meme chose sur
> mon laptop, jusqu'a ce que je tombe, dans la doc de nVidia je crois, > sur une petite phrase du genre "Sur les laptops et/ou geforce 2 go, > l'ecran externe est considere comme le master". Ca date du temps du > kernel 2.4, donc il est possible que les gars de nVidia se soit > grouiller le derriere pour regler ca.
Ah oui j'ai oublie de preciser le hardware derriere :) Il s'agit d'un GeforceFX5950. Donc c'est pas du laptop ni de la geforce2. Je vais voir si je trouve ca dans la doc nvidia-glx mais j'avais deja regarde....
Personnellement, je roule deux serveurs X lorsque je suis en dualhead.
> Ca fonctionne bien, mais on ne peut pas deplacer de fenetre d'un > desktop a l'autre.
Oui, c'est la configue que j'avais avant de vouloir essayer xinerama, si jamais j'y arrive vraiment pas j'y retournerais mais j'aime pas avoir un probleme non resolu! :) Je trouve quand meme fout que le master soit le CRT et pas le TFT ....
-- Pensez à lire la FAQ de la liste avant de poser une question : http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to with a subject of "unsubscribe". Trouble? Contact
Xavier Henner
> J'ai essaye de mettre mon poste en dualhead avec xinerama, pas de pb a l'horizon sauf que je n'arrive pas a lui faire comprendre que je veux que l'ecran principal soit le TFT et non le CRT. Ce qui est genant par exemple pour l'opengl qui ne tourne que sur l'ecran principale.
pour l'histoire d'openGL, il y a peut etre plus simple : utiliser le mode twinview du driver proprio (tant qu'a utiliser ce dernier, autant le faire completement) Ca émule xinerama mais c'est completement géré par le driver nvidia, une couche en dessous donc.
Avantage : openGL sur les 2 écrans. On peut meme passer une fenetre openGL d'un écran a l'autre, pareil pour les video ou les sources v4l. C'est pour l'instant, et de loin, la meilleure solution dualhead que j'ai jamais vu, loin devant ce que peut offrir un windows (pour OSX, faudrait que je teste ca plus a fond un de ces jours) et toutes cartes confondues (je fais du dualhead depuis 8 ans maintenant, et j'ai tout testé ou presque).
Détail : a l'usage, la conf twinview est la plus stable, j'ai eu des merdes en conf xinerama "classique"
Il y a des exemples de conf dans /usr/share/docs/nvidia-glx/
Sinon, le "principal", c'est toujours le port CRT, pas le port DVI, bien qu'avec la config en twinview, ca n'ait plus aucun sens.
En wm, j'ai gnome et ca marche nickel, comme en "pur" xinerama, les petits avantages en plus.
Voila l'extrait de ma conf concernant le twinview, c'est un copier coller de la doc nvidia.
Section "Device" Identifier "NV AGP TwinView" VendorName "nvidia" Driver "nvidia" BusID "PCI:1:5:0" Option "TwinView" # be sure to replace the HorizSync and VertRefresh with correct values # for your monitor! Option "SecondMonitorHorizSync" "30-96" Option "SecondMonitorVertRefresh" "50-180" Option "TwinViewOrientation" "RightOf" Option "MetaModes" "1280x1024,1152x864" Option "ConnectedMonitor" "crt,crt" EndSection
-- Pensez à lire la FAQ de la liste avant de poser une question : http://wiki.debian.net/?DebianFrench
Pensez à rajouter le mot ``spam'' dans vos champs "From" et "Reply-To:"
To UNSUBSCRIBE, email to with a subject of "unsubscribe". Trouble? Contact
> J'ai essaye de mettre mon poste en dualhead avec xinerama, pas de pb a
l'horizon sauf que je n'arrive pas a lui faire comprendre que je veux
que l'ecran principal soit le TFT et non le CRT. Ce qui est genant par
exemple pour l'opengl qui ne tourne que sur l'ecran principale.
pour l'histoire d'openGL, il y a peut etre plus simple : utiliser le mode
twinview du driver proprio (tant qu'a utiliser ce dernier, autant le faire
completement)
Ca émule xinerama mais c'est completement géré par le driver nvidia, une couche
en dessous donc.
Avantage : openGL sur les 2 écrans. On peut meme passer une fenetre openGL d'un
écran a l'autre, pareil pour les video ou les sources v4l. C'est pour
l'instant, et de loin, la meilleure solution dualhead que j'ai jamais vu, loin
devant ce que peut offrir un windows (pour OSX, faudrait que je teste ca plus a
fond un de ces jours) et toutes cartes confondues (je fais du dualhead depuis 8
ans maintenant, et j'ai tout testé ou presque).
Détail : a l'usage, la conf twinview est la plus stable, j'ai eu des merdes en
conf xinerama "classique"
Il y a des exemples de conf dans /usr/share/docs/nvidia-glx/
Sinon, le "principal", c'est toujours le port CRT, pas le port DVI, bien
qu'avec la config en twinview, ca n'ait plus aucun sens.
En wm, j'ai gnome et ca marche nickel, comme en "pur" xinerama, les petits
avantages en plus.
Voila l'extrait de ma conf concernant le twinview, c'est un copier coller de
la doc nvidia.
Section "Device"
Identifier "NV AGP TwinView"
VendorName "nvidia"
Driver "nvidia"
BusID "PCI:1:5:0"
Option "TwinView"
# be sure to replace the HorizSync and VertRefresh with correct values
# for your monitor!
Option "SecondMonitorHorizSync" "30-96"
Option "SecondMonitorVertRefresh" "50-180"
Option "TwinViewOrientation" "RightOf"
Option "MetaModes" "1280x1024,1152x864"
Option "ConnectedMonitor" "crt,crt"
EndSection
> J'ai essaye de mettre mon poste en dualhead avec xinerama, pas de pb a l'horizon sauf que je n'arrive pas a lui faire comprendre que je veux que l'ecran principal soit le TFT et non le CRT. Ce qui est genant par exemple pour l'opengl qui ne tourne que sur l'ecran principale.
pour l'histoire d'openGL, il y a peut etre plus simple : utiliser le mode twinview du driver proprio (tant qu'a utiliser ce dernier, autant le faire completement) Ca émule xinerama mais c'est completement géré par le driver nvidia, une couche en dessous donc.
Avantage : openGL sur les 2 écrans. On peut meme passer une fenetre openGL d'un écran a l'autre, pareil pour les video ou les sources v4l. C'est pour l'instant, et de loin, la meilleure solution dualhead que j'ai jamais vu, loin devant ce que peut offrir un windows (pour OSX, faudrait que je teste ca plus a fond un de ces jours) et toutes cartes confondues (je fais du dualhead depuis 8 ans maintenant, et j'ai tout testé ou presque).
Détail : a l'usage, la conf twinview est la plus stable, j'ai eu des merdes en conf xinerama "classique"
Il y a des exemples de conf dans /usr/share/docs/nvidia-glx/
Sinon, le "principal", c'est toujours le port CRT, pas le port DVI, bien qu'avec la config en twinview, ca n'ait plus aucun sens.
En wm, j'ai gnome et ca marche nickel, comme en "pur" xinerama, les petits avantages en plus.
Voila l'extrait de ma conf concernant le twinview, c'est un copier coller de la doc nvidia.
Section "Device" Identifier "NV AGP TwinView" VendorName "nvidia" Driver "nvidia" BusID "PCI:1:5:0" Option "TwinView" # be sure to replace the HorizSync and VertRefresh with correct values # for your monitor! Option "SecondMonitorHorizSync" "30-96" Option "SecondMonitorVertRefresh" "50-180" Option "TwinViewOrientation" "RightOf" Option "MetaModes" "1280x1024,1152x864" Option "ConnectedMonitor" "crt,crt" EndSection